Summary:
Adm. Brad Cooper, commander of U.S. Central Command (CENTCOM), stated on April 9 that Iran had experienced a "generational military defeat" following a conflict with the United States. He described the U.S. military deployment in the Middle East as aimed at dismantling Iran's ability to project power beyond its borders, a goal that was reportedly achieved. According to Cooper, Iran's capability to conduct large-scale military operations has been destroyed for years to come. These remarks were made two days after a ceasefire agreement between the U.S. and Iran was announced.

Source Excerpt:
The head of the U.S. military command in charge of combat operations in Iran said that the country “suffered a generational military defeat” in the conflict, in remarks made two days after a ceasefire agreement between Iran and the United States was announced. Adm. Brad Cooper, the commander of Central Command (CENTCOM), said on April 9 that the military was deployed in the Middle East to “dismantle the Iranian regime’s ability to project power beyond its own borders, and we clearly accomplished this task,” adding that Iran’s capacity to “conduct large-scale military operations” was destroyed for “years to come.”......
